Position Description Summary:
The Department of Psychiatry and Behavioral Health at The George Washington University Medical Faculty Associates (MFA), a non-profit clinical practice group affiliated with The George Washington University, is seeking academic outpatient psychiatrists for full-time appointments in the outpatient division.
These non-tenure track positions will be made at a rank (Instructor/Assistant/Associate/Professor) and salary commensurate with experience.
Specific Duties and Responsibilities:
Responsibilities will include (1) outpatient psychiatry clinical practice; (2) teaching and clinical supervision with medical students and psychiatry residents; and (3) opportunities for clinical research.
Minimum Qualifications:
Applicants must be license-eligible in the District of Columbia and be board-certified or board-eligible in General Psychiatry at the time of appointment.
